In the world of technology and telecommunications, the term high gain refers to the ability of an antenna or a system to amplify signals significantly. This characteristic is crucial for ensuring effective communication over long distances. For example, in satellite communications, antennas with high gain are essential as they can capture weak signals from distant satellites and enhance them for clearer transmission. Without high gain capabilities, the quality of communication would suffer, leading to interruptions and loss of information.Moreover, high gain can also be applied in various fields such as audio engineering, where it describes the amplification of sound signals. In this context, devices that provide high gain are vital for live performances and recording studios, enabling musicians to project their sound effectively. The ability to achieve high gain in audio systems allows for a richer and more immersive listening experience, which is particularly important in large venues where sound can dissipate quickly.In the realm of scientific research, high gain plays a significant role in enhancing the sensitivity of measurement instruments. For instance, in physics experiments, detectors with high gain can identify faint signals that would otherwise go unnoticed. This capability allows researchers to gather more data and make groundbreaking discoveries, pushing the boundaries of human knowledge.
